In case you haven't looked at a calendar yet in 2023, tomorrow is Friday the 13th!

We're all aware of some of the more common superstitions we should all avoid doing (walking under a ladder; breaking a mirror), but what about the more uncommon superstitions?  You need to be aware of those, too!


Believe it or not, a ton of bad things have actually happened on Friday the 13th!

According to Romper.com, hundreds of the Knights Templar were arrested by King Philip IV of France on Friday, Oct. 13, 1307, and many members of the group were then imprisoned and executed so King Philip could gain access to their riches.

Many believe this event could be where the legendary date's unluckiness stems from.

Since then, the bombing of Buckingham Palace in 1940, a destructive cyclone in Bangladesh in 1970, and rapper Tupac Shakur's death in 1996 all occurred on Friday the 13th!

So what are some of the more uncommon superstitions you need to avoid doing, especially tomorrow?

Getting a haircut – Some believe this could lead to the death of a family member
Crossing your eyes – Some believe they could get stuck that way
Holding your hands under a full moon – Some legends say this could lead to distrust
Eating a jawbreaker – This choking hazard is apparently especially hazardous on Friday the 13th
Staring at an owl through a window – Some believe this is a sign that death looms nearby
